[RFC PATCH v2 1/7] vfio-ccw: Return IOINST_CC_NOT_OPERATIONAL for EIO


From: Eric Farman
Subject: [RFC PATCH v2 1/7] vfio-ccw: Return IOINST_CC_NOT_OPERATIONAL for EIO
Date: Thu, 6 Feb 2020 22:45:03 +0100

From: Farhan Ali <address@hidden>

EIO is returned by vfio-ccw mediated device when the backing
host subchannel is not operational anymore. So return cc=3
back to the guest, rather than returning a unit check.
This way the guest can take appropriate action such as
issue an 'stsch'.
